YORK, Pa. – The FDU-Florham swim team completed their final day at MAC Championships on Sunday morning.
Devils Highlights
- Senior Michael Bang qualified for the 100-yard freestyle B final with a time of 49.32. On the women's side of this event, seniors Katelyn Plank, Magda Konopka, Lauren Stone, and sophomore Caitlyn Kramaritsch all managed to qualify for finals. Both Plank and Konopka qualified for the A final, with Plank finishes in seventh with a time of 54.54 and Konopka finishing eighth with a time of 54.97. Similarly, Stone and Kramaritsch qualified for the C final, finishing with times of 58.35 and 58.67.
- In the 200-yard backstroke, first year Jillian Rhyshek, sophomore Olivia Case, and senior Jessica Mooney all managed to qualify for evening finals. Rhyshek qualified for the A final with a time of 2:14.11, Case qualified for the B final with a time of 2:20.25, and Mooney qualified for the C final with a time of 2:23.59. Finally, senior Jackson Standridge and sophomore Olivia Glenfield both qualified for finals within the 200-yard breaststroke event. Glenfield qualified for the B final with a time of 2:36.18, while Standridge qualified for the C final with a time of 2:30.03.
- For the evening session, Bang swam in the 100-yard freestyle B final, finishing second with a time of 49.06. Konopka and Plank both swam in the 200-yard freestyle A final, with Konopka finishing sixth with a time of 54.36 and Plank finishing eighth with a time of 55.90. In the same event's C final, Stone finished seventh with a time of 58.71, while Kramaritsch finished eighth with a time of 59.44.
